John Gill's Bible Commentary

Ver. 15. My son,
walk not thou in the way with them , etc.] In the same way as they do, which is the broad way that leads unto destruction; set not one foot in it; make no trial of it, whether it will be pleasant and profitable walking in it; the experiment will be dangerous; refrain thy foot from their path ; their manner and course of life; do not follow it, nor join them in it; when there is an inclination or a temptation to it, withstand it; stop in time, do not proceed, but draw back, and go on in the way thou hast been trained up in, and remember the instructions of thy parents.

Matthew Henry Commentary

Verses 10-19 -
Wicked people are zealous in seducing others into the paths of the destroyer: sinners love company in sin. But they have so much the mor to answer for. How cautious young people should be! "Consent thou not. Do not say as they say, nor do as they do, or would have thee to do have no fellowship with them. Who could think that it should be pleasure to one man to destroy another! See their idea of worldl wealth; but it is neither substance, nor precious. It is the ruinou mistake of thousands, that they overvalue the wealth of this world. Me promise themselves in vain that sin will turn to their advantage. The way of sin is down-hill; men cannot stop themselves. Would young people shun temporal and eternal ruin, let them refuse to take one step i these destructive paths. Men's greediness of gain hurries them upo practices which will not suffer them or others to live out half their days. What is a man profited, though he gain the world, if he lose his life? much less if he lose his soul?
